my main character is a fighter/mage. i also have a fighter with a bow, a dwarven fighter with hammers, for those pesky @ss golems, a cleric, also with hammers, clerics are important for the healing and resurection at high levels. i love to play elves, and it is the only thing that will bring them back. besides, healing is very important when you are in a place where you CANT rest. i also have a fighter/thief, so i can backstab and do alot of damage. and i ended my party with a paladin, just to give me another fighter, he has a two handed sword, just for damage, and variety. personaly i think that the party depends on the interests of the person playing them. i like to play with fighters, and mages alot. once i went through with a fighter/mage, a thief/mage, a cleric/mage, and three straight mages. let me tell you, that was a fun @ss experience, all i did was cast stonespells, and mirror images, and minor globes, and i was rockin. except when i ran into guys with magic resistance, then i had to memorize lower magic resistance, and rest. anywho, im babbling again, so ill just shut up. later
